What the team is known for

Baker McKenzie is a well-regarded practice group advising prominent international and domestic companies. The law firm assists with merger control matters, frequently working alongside the firm's competition team in Brussels on multi-jurisdictional filings. The team represents clients in PCA investigations into possible price fixing and consumer protection issues, as well as acting for them on challenges to authority decisions.
